Dry dock vessels can sink and float

Right under the Coronado Bridge is California's largest floating drydock. This vessel, christened Pride of California, purposefully floods itself and sinks low enough so a ship can sail inside. The dry dock can then resurface, bringing the ship inside it out of the water for repairs.

How can a vessel sink and float on command? What causes a vessel to float? Why do some objects sink and some float?
